Parallel Curves (2-6 parallel curves)
- LaTeX macros (as usual),
- TikZ styles,
-
\foreachloops for repeating things.
Code: Select all
\draw[thick, color=..., domain=1:5] Code: Select all
\draw[plot, color=...] \tikzset:Code: Select all
\begin{tikzpicture}[scale=0.9,
plot/.style = {thick, domain=1:5}
]You can use loops like this:
Code: Select all
\foreach \i/\x/\y in {1/0cm/0cm, 2/0.5cm/0.5cm, 3/1cm/1cm} {
\draw [plot, color=red, xshift=\x, yshift=\y]
plot(\adone) node[right] {AD\textsubscript{\i}};}
\foreach \x/\y in {0cm/0cm, -0.5cm/0.5cm, -1cm/1cm} {
\draw [plot, color=blue, xshift=\x, yshift=\y]
plot(\easone);}\foreach is explained in the
TikZ manual in 83 Repeating Things: The Foreach Statement. You can open it by typing texdoc tikz or texdoc pgf at the command prompt.Stefan
